Ashtead Station, managed by Southern, offers a variety of amenities to cater to travelers' diverse need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to late at night, ensuring you can purchase tickets and seek assistance throughout much of the day. Ticket machines, accessible to all, are fitted to acc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although you might want to verify accessibility across the station first.
Passenger support is a priority with help points and staff available most of the day. While luggage storage options are not available, there's plenty of seating, and for those keen on staying connected, pay phones are provided.
At Ashtead Station, accessibility is thoughtfully integrated. While the station offers partial step-free access through level crossings, it’s advisable to pre-book assistance or reach out for help upon your arrival. The station staff are trained and willing to assist, including using ramps for boarding trains.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, there are accessible ticket machines and a designated drop-off and pick-up point for travelers with impaired mobility.
Connectivity options surround Ashtead Station, making onward travel a breeze. Although direct bus links from the station itself aren't highlighted, local bus services can be found nearby. For those needing it, more information on replacement bus services is readily available online.

However you choose to journey, Ashtead caters with ample car parking operated by APCOA Parking UK, open 24 hours, offering 240 spaces including 12 dedicated to accessible parking. Cyclists are also accommodated with storage stands located safely within the station’s car park.
